Hi, I need help deciding which parts to replace on the back of my fridge. The age is a best guess, because it came with the house I'm living in. It is still running properly, but the clicking noise is on a cycle that has been going off and on almost 12 hours now, possibly longer.

I would appreciate any help and guidance you can give me.

Can you tell if the clicking noise is coming from inside the cabinet or outside and what general area, high or low? Is it a rapid clicking or rhythmic at all?

The clicking is simply a fast speed, but it seems to vary in rhythm from time to time. I have heard it change sounds, but it would be hard to describe the change unless I hear it again.

The sound is coming from the outside lower left area (when standing in front of the fridge). I do not have the ice-maker functioning at this time if that helps narrow it down.

Well, the condenser fan motor is down there. I wonder if a piece of paper or something is in the blade, getting knocked around a bit. Can you remove the cover from that lower area and inspect that fan blade area?
